Typical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(Smaller scope)
$4,500 - $10,000 (Lar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or Leak Repair |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Pipe Replacement | $3,000 - $7,000 |
| Full Main Replacement |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Valve Installation | $2,000 - $4,500 |
| Line Relocation | $10,000 - $25,000 |
Material quality, repair complexity, and location
Water main repair projects in Lilburn, GA, can vary in scope and complexity depending on several factors. Understanding typical costs and considerations can help in planning and comparison. Below are key aspects to consider when evaluating water main repair options in the area.
- Materials: Common materials include ductile iron, PVC, or copper piping, chosen based on durability and compatibility with existing infrastructure.
- Size and Scope: Repairs may involve small sections or extensive replacements, with pipe diameters typically ranging from 4 to 12 inches, affecting overall project scale.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as excavation depth, urban setting, and proximity to existing utilities influence the complexity and duration of labor involved.
- Permitting: Projects generally require permits from local authorities, which can involve inspection and approval processes before work begins.
- Additional Considerations: Temporary water service disruptions, site restoration, and adherence to local codes are common extras to plan for during repair projects.
Extent of damage and pipe size
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Residential Water Main (up to 6 inches) |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Commercial Water Main (6-12 inches) | $10,000 - $50,000 |
| Large Diameter Main (>12 inches) | $50,000 and up |
| Emergency Repairs | Varies based on extent |
